【发布时间】:2015-07-20 10:19:54
【问题描述】:
用户有什么方法可以选择我的应用程序的应用程序名称和启动器图标并以编程方式进行设置?
我想授予用户权限,以便他可以重命名我的应用程序并更改应用程序的启动器图标。
有什么解决办法吗?
【问题讨论】:
用户有什么方法可以选择我的应用程序的应用程序名称和启动器图标并以编程方式进行设置?
我想授予用户权限,以便他可以重命名我的应用程序并更改应用程序的启动器图标。
有什么解决办法吗?
【问题讨论】:
您唯一能做的就是使用预定义的图标和标签定义多个启动器活动,并以编程方式启用/禁用它们。
setComponentEnabledSetting (ComponentName componentName, int newState, int flags)
【讨论】:
不可能轻易更改这些值中的任何一个。您可以从应用程序内部创建新的启动器图标,然后更轻松地控制它们 - 就像其他答案所暗示的那样)。
最重要的是,据我所知,使用标准 Android 框架不容易做到这一点。
【讨论】: